Incorrect!  *Every* FreeToastHost website can be accessed via multiple URLs, one of which is *always active*, uses your club number, and is provided by the system.  Brian is just giving you that URL to show you that your website is still there, but your custom domain url is not set up correctly.  That is why you are having issues with it.

Custom URLs are obtained via paying a registrar such as GoDaddy or similar (not us).  

If you do not think you will be able to fix the custom URL DNS settings, I would recommend that you consider using a website alias URL version (another URL you can use) which will allow you to define a more descriptive name than the club number version, and it is *free*.

Club # URL version and website alias URL version are both free and "baked" into the design of FreeToastHost.   The system defines the club # version, but you can define the website alias used for the website alias version.

Custom domain names are not free and must be obtained via a registrar.
